Aspergillus fumigatus conidia stimulate lung epithelial cells (TC-1 JHU-1) to produce IL-12, IFNγ, IL-13 and IL-17 cytokines: Modulatory effect of propolis extract
This study was designed to evaluate the effect of A. fumigatus conidia on IL-12, IFNγ, IL-13 and IL-17 release from mouse LECs and to investigate the effect of propolis on cytokines modulation. Cells were divided to two groups, one was exposed to 3 × 104 conidia of Aspergillus fumigatus and another group was treated by propolis (25 μg/mL) as well as exposed to A. fumigatus conidia. Cytokines IL-13, IL-12, IFNγ and IL-17 were measured at times 0, 6 and 12 hours after exposure using ELISA assay. Molecular characterization of Aspergilli isolated from outdoor air
Publication date: Available online 3 October 2018Source: Journal de Mycologie MédicaleAuthor(s): S. Aghaei-Gharehbolagh, M. Shams-Ghahfarokhi, S. Amanloo, M. Razzaghi-AbyanehAbstractUbiquitous airborne conidia of the genus Aspergillus are responsible for a diverse group of human disorders from allergy to life treating invasive aspergillosis and mycotoxicoses. The aim of this study was to determine the population structure of Aspergillus isolated from outdoor air in Tehran by comparing the nucleotide sequences of ITS region and the PCR-RFLP molecular method. Environmental and molecular study of fungal flora in asthmatic patients
Publication date: March 2018Source: Journal de Mycologie Médicale, Volume 28, Issue 1Author(s): H. Trablesi, I. Hadrich, S. Neji, N. Fendri, D. Ghorbel, F. Makni, H. Ayadi, S. Kammoun, A. AyadiSummaryThe aim of the present study was to investigate the epidemiological and fungal environmental profile in asthmatic patients. We conducted a prospective study involving 49 patients with allergic asthma. One hundred and forty-five clinical samples and 289 environmental samples were performed.
